Abstract

An agricultural rotary-type peanut pulling-out apparatus, comprising a cart (1), a collection box (2), a rotary motor (3), a rotary rod (4), a sliding rail I (5), a gripping apparatus (6), a support (7), a sliding block I (8), a steel wire rope I (9), an electric wheel I (10), an electric wheel II (11), a steel wire rope II (12), and the like. A left side of the bottom inside the collection box (2) is provided with the electric wheel II (11), the steel wire rope II (12) is wound on the electric wheel II (11), the top of a right side of the collection box (2) is provided with a fixing cover (13), and the top of a left side of the collection box (2) is hingedly connected to a turning cover (14). The peanut pulling-out apparatus can pull out peanuts quickly, reduce the amount of labor of a user and improve working efficiency.

工作原理:当需要拔花生时,用户将推车推到合适的位置处停下,用户控制减速电机转动,带动绕线轮逆时针转动,收钢丝绳Ⅲ,同时控制电动轮Ⅱ逆时针转动,放钢丝绳Ⅱ,因为翻转盖与收集框左侧顶部铰接连接,通过钢丝绳Ⅲ的作用带动翻转盖逆时针转动,弹簧Ⅰ伸长,当翻转盖逆时针转动合适角度后,关闭减速电机和电动轮Ⅱ。再控制电动轮Ⅰ顺时针转动,放钢丝绳Ⅰ,滑块Ⅰ在重力的作用下向下移动,带动夹紧装置向下移动,当夹紧装置向下移动到方便夹住花生杆后,关闭电动轮Ⅰ。控制气缸收缩,带动滚球向左移动,带动拉线向左移动,通过拉线的作用,带动前后两侧滑块Ⅱ互相靠拢,带动前后两侧压板互相靠拢,将花生杆夹紧,当花生杆夹紧后,关闭气缸,此时弹簧Ⅱ均处于拉伸状态。控制电动轮 Ⅰ逆时针转动,收钢丝绳Ⅰ,带动滑块Ⅰ向上移动,带动夹紧装置向上移动,同时控制旋转电机转动,带动转杆顺时针转动,带动滑轨Ⅰ及其上装置顺时针转动,带动夹紧装置顺时针转动,使夹紧装置在向上移动的同时还顺时针转动,可以更好地将花生拔起,当花生被拔起后,关闭电动轮Ⅰ。旋转电机继续顺时针转动,带动花生顺时针转动,当旋转电机顺时针转动180°后,花生恰好位于收集框的正上方后,此时关闭旋转电机。再控制电动轮Ⅰ顺时针转动,放钢丝绳Ⅰ,滑块Ⅰ在重力的作用下向下移动,带动夹紧装置向下移动,当花生果实向下移动到收集框内后,关闭电动轮Ⅰ。控制减速电机顺时针转动,带动绕线轮顺时针转动,放钢丝绳Ⅲ,同时控制电动轮Ⅱ顺时针转动,收钢丝绳Ⅱ,因为翻转盖与收集框左侧顶部铰接连接,在弹簧Ⅰ和钢丝绳Ⅱ的作用下,带动翻转盖顺时针转动,当翻转盖顺时针转动到夹紧花生杆后,关闭减速电机和电动轮Ⅱ,此时花生果实留在收集框内,花生杆在收集框外。控制电动轮Ⅰ逆时针转动,收钢丝绳Ⅰ,带动滑块Ⅰ向上移动,带动夹紧装置向上移动,夹紧装置向上拔花生,使花生果实被拔落下来,落到收集框中,花生杆继续向上移动,当花生杆全部向上移出收集框后,关闭电动轮Ⅰ。再控制旋转电机逆时针转动,带动转杆逆时针转动,带动Ⅰ及滑轨其上装置逆顺时针转动,带动夹紧装置逆时针转动,带动花生杆逆时针转动,当旋转电机逆时针转动180°后,关闭旋转电机,用户将推车推到合适的位置处停下,控制电动轮Ⅰ顺时针转动,放钢丝绳Ⅰ,滑块Ⅰ在重力的作用下向下移动,带动夹紧装置向下移动,当花生杆到向下移动到合适位置后,关闭电动轮Ⅰ。控制气缸伸长,带动滚球向右移动,带动拉线向右移动,通过弹簧Ⅱ的作用使动前后两侧滑块Ⅱ互相分开,带动前后两侧压板互相分开,使花生杆落下,当气缸复位后,关闭气缸。当需要拔另一处的花生时,重复上述动作,可以快速地将花生拔起,当收集框内有合适的花生果实后,用户将收集框内的花生果实装袋。Working principle: When the peanuts need to be pulled out, the user pushes the cart to the appropriate position to stop, the user controls the gear motor to rotate, drives the reel to rotate counterclockwise, collects the wire rope III, and simultaneously controls the electric wheel II to rotate counterclockwise. Wire rope II, because the flip cover is hingedly connected to the top left side of the collecting frame, the rotating cover is rotated counterclockwise by the action of the wire rope III, the spring I is extended, and when the flip cover is rotated counterclockwise by a suitable angle, the geared motor and the electric wheel II are turned off. Then control the electric wheel I to rotate clockwise, put the wire rope I, the slider I moves downward under the action of gravity, and drives the clamping device to move downward. When the clamping device moves down to facilitate the clamping of the peanut rod, the electric motor is turned off. Wheel I. Control the cylinder contraction, drive the ball to move to the left, and drive the cable to move to the left. By the action of the cable, the sliders II on the front and rear sides are brought closer to each other, and the pressure plates on the front and the rear are brought closer to each other to clamp the peanut rod. Immediately after closing, the cylinder is closed and the spring II is in tension. Control electric wheel I counterclockwise rotation, take the wire rope I, drive the slider I to move upwards, drive the clamping device to move upwards, and control the rotation of the rotating motor to drive the rotating rod to rotate clockwise, driving the sliding rail I and its upper device to rotate clockwise, driving the clamp The tightening device rotates clockwise, so that the clamping device rotates clockwise while moving upwards, so that the peanuts can be pulled up better, and when the peanuts are pulled up, the electric wheel I is turned off. The rotating motor continues to rotate clockwise, which drives the peanut to rotate clockwise. When the rotating motor rotates 180° clockwise, the peanut is just above the collecting frame, and the rotating motor is turned off. Then control the electric wheel I to rotate clockwise, put the wire rope I, the slider I moves downward under the action of gravity, and drives the clamping device to move downward. When the peanut fruit moves down into the collecting frame, the electric wheel I is turned off. Control the geared motor to rotate clockwise, drive the reel to rotate clockwise, put the wire rope III, and control the electric wheel II to rotate clockwise, and receive the wire rope II, because the flip cover is hingedly connected with the top left side of the collecting frame, in the spring I and the wire rope II Under the action, the flip cover is rotated clockwise. When the flip cover rotates clockwise to clamp the peanut rod, the gear motor and the electric wheel II are turned off, and the peanut fruit is left in the collecting frame, and the peanut rod is outside the collecting frame. Control the electric wheel I to rotate counterclockwise, take the wire rope I, drive the slider I to move upwards, drive the clamping device to move upwards, the clamping device pulls up the peanuts, the peanut fruit is pulled down, falls into the collecting box, and the peanut rod continues Move up and turn off the electric wheel I when the peanut rods are all moved up out of the collection box. Then control the rotating motor to rotate counterclockwise, drive the rotating rod to rotate counterclockwise, drive the I and the slide rail to rotate counterclockwise, and drive the clamping device to rotate counterclockwise to drive the peanut rod to rotate counterclockwise. When the rotating motor rotates counterclockwise 180 After °, turn off the rotating motor, the user pushes the cart to the appropriate position to stop, control the electric wheel I to rotate clockwise, put the wire rope I, the slider I moves downward under the action of gravity, and drives the clamping device down. Move, turn off the electric wheel I when the peanut rod moves down to the proper position. Control the cylinder elongation, drive the ball to the right, drive the cable to the right, and move the front and rear sliders II apart from each other by the action of the spring II, driving the front and rear pressure plates to separate from each other, so that the peanut rod falls, when the cylinder is reset After that, close the cylinder. When the peanuts in another place need to be pulled out, the above actions can be repeated, and the peanuts can be quickly pulled up. When there is a suitable peanut fruit in the collection box, the user will bag the peanut fruits in the collection box.
